ai didi

十六进制到十六进制的 Python 字符串(带前导零)

转载 作者:太空宇宙 更新时间:2023-11-03 11:06:28 24 4
gpt4 key购买 nike

我在 Python 中遇到十六进制转换问题。

我有一个表示十六进制数字的字符串 - "02",我想将它转换为 0x02 并将其连接到另一个十六进制数字。

我的代码:

valToWrite1 = '\x3c'
valToWrite2 = '02'

我想加入这 2 个值,这样我的结果就是 "\x3c\x02"。保留前导零很重要。

最佳答案

你需要binascii.unhexlify() :

>>> import binascii
>>> binascii.unhexlify("02")
'\x02'
>>> '\x3c' + _
'<\x02'

关于十六进制到十六进制的 Python 字符串(带前导零),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18040964/

24 4 0
文章推荐: c# - 我对 session 状态序列化有疑问
文章推荐: python - 如何在 Plone 中中止工作流转换
文章推荐: python - 字节到字符串的转换
文章推荐: python - 在 Python 中使用索引删除项目的就地函数
太空宇宙
个人简介

我是一名优秀的程序员,十分优秀!

滴滴打车优惠券免费领取
滴滴打车优惠券
全站热门文章
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com